
Little bear cub woke up. Its tummy went rumble, rumble! The honey pot was empty. Oh no!

The cub trotted into the forest. It saw bright red berries. The cub tried one. Ptooey! Too sour!

The cub sniffed and sniffed. It saw a tall oak tree. Nuts! But a speedy squirrel had gathered them all. Chatter, chatter!

The cub felt sleepy, but its tummy still rumbled. Then, a tiny buzzy sound. Bzzzzzz! A small, low beehive!

Carefully, the cub reached up. Plop! A piece of honeycomb fell into its paw! Sweet, sticky honey! The cub licked its paw, happy at last, then curled up for a nap.
When you keep looking and trying, you might find just what you need.
